  • The study uses bibliometric method includes quantitative analysis of the publications of authors Argentine institutions located in web search engines as Google and Google Scholar, specialized digital repositories as E-LIS (E-Prints in Library and Information Science), digital libraries as SciELO and RedALyC and SCOPUS database, Elsevier, being the data source most comprehensive multidisciplinary and international in the world. The terms used for searches on these sources have been "bibliometrics", "bibliometric analysis" and equivalent terms in English "Bibliometric" and "scientometric", to which he added the name of Argentina to identify and work together on the that at least one of the authors included the mention of an institution in Argentina institutional affiliation data. There was time delimitation, but tracked all studies regardless of the year, being the first one published in 1984. It should be noted that a significant number of publications is being compiled studied for years by one of the authors taking this task is tremendous value in the generation of a data source bibliometric studies conducted by researchers Argentines, who would otherwise be dispersed.
